The Mond process is used to purify Nickel (Ni).
Nickel has atomic number 28.
The electronic configuration of Ni is:
\[ \text{Ni: } [\text{Ar}]\, 3d^8\, 4s^2 \]
In the ground state, the \(3d^8\) configuration has 2 unpaired electrons.
